Guide

Managing Devices

The Devices section allows administrators to monitor, link, and manage all Android devices connected to TextGem. Each connected device acts as an SMS gateway, enabling messages to be sent directly using the device's SIM card. This page provides a centralized view of device details, connection status, SIM information, and available management actions.

Overview

The Devices page displays all linked devices associated with customer accounts. Administrators can search for devices, filter devices by customer, link new devices, and manage existing device connections.

The information displayed helps ensure that connected devices remain active and ready to process SMS requests.

Device Status

The Status column indicates whether a device is currently available for SMS processing.

Common Status Values

Enabled – The device is active and ready to send messages.
Disabled – The device is inactive and unavailable for message processing.

Administrators should regularly verify that important devices remain enabled.

Editing a Device Overview

The Edit Device window provides a simple interface for modifying the device name. After entering a valid name, the changes can be saved immediately without affecting the device’s existing connection.

Update the Device Name

The Device Name field allows you to modify the display name of the selected device.

To Update the Device Name

Click inside the Device Name field.
Enter the new device name.
Ensure the name follows the required naming format.
Review the entered value before saving.

Naming Requirement

The device name must include a hyphen (-).
Example:

  • Samsung-SM100
  • Redmi-Note12
  • Pixel-8Pro

Using a consistent naming format helps identify devices more easily throughout the platform.

Save the Changes

After updating the device name, save the new information.

To Save

Verify the updated device name.
Click Update Device.
The system validates the input.
If the validation is successful, the updated name is reflected in the Devices list.

Cancel the Update

If you do not want to apply the changes, click Cancel to close the dialog without saving the updated device name.

Validation

Before saving, the system validates the entered device name.

Validation Rules

Device Name is required.
The device name must contain a hyphen (-).
The entered name should follow the supported device naming format.

If the validation fails, an appropriate message is displayed, allowing you to correct the input before updating.

Linking a Device

The Link Devices dialog allows administrators to connect a new Android device to the TextGem platform. Each linked device can be used as an SMS gateway, enabling messages to be sent through its installed SIM card. Devices can be linked by scanning the displayed QR code or by using the generated pairing code.

Linking a Device overview

The Link Devices window provides two secure methods for pairing a mobile device with the TextGem platform:

Scan the QR code using the TextGem mobile application.
Enter or copy the generated pairing code if QR scanning is unavailable.

Once the pairing process is completed successfully, the device will appear in the Devices list and become available for SMS operations.

Scan the QR Code

A unique QR code is generated whenever the Link Devices window is opened.

To Link Using the QR Code

Open the TextGem Mobile App on the Android device.
Navigate to the device linking option.
Scan the QR code displayed on the screen.
Wait for the pairing process to complete.
The device will automatically be registered in TextGem.

Benefits

Fast and secure pairing.
Eliminates manual code entry.
Reduces setup errors.

Use the Pairing Code

If QR scanning is not available, you can use the generated pairing code.

To Link Using the Pairing Code

Copy the displayed pairing code using the Copy button.
Open the TextGem mobile application.
Enter the copied pairing code.
Complete the pairing process.

The pairing code uniquely identifies the connection request and securely links the device.

Copy the Pairing Code

The Copy button allows you to quickly copy the generated pairing code to your clipboard.

To Copy

Click the Copy icon.
Paste the code into the TextGem mobile application when prompted.

This avoids typing errors during manual device pairing.

Complete the Linking Process

After the device has been paired successfully, finalize the process.

To Finish

Verify that the device has connected successfully.
Click Done to close the dialog.
Confirm that the new device appears in the Devices list.

The device is now ready to send SMS messages through the selected SIM card.

Cancel the Process

If you do not want to continue with device pairing, click Cancel to close the dialog without linking the device.

Best Practices

Ensure the Android device has an active internet connection before pairing.
Use the latest version of the TextGem mobile application.
Complete the pairing process promptly, as pairing codes may expire.
Verify the device appears in the Devices list after linking.
Test the newly linked device by sending a sample SMS to confirm successful connectivity.
